Dave Oberg is the Executive Director of the Elmhurst History Museum and possesses a B.A. in History and Political Science from Rockford University and an M.A. in History, with a focus in Historical Administration, from Northern Illinois University. He has worked for 30 years in the museum industry and is the author of numerous articles and two books about local history. He is also a homebrewer, craft beer enthusiast, highly experienced player of roleplaying games, and long-time friend of the Ludophilia crew.

A History of Beer: Beer and civilization are deeply entwined. In fact, beer predates written language and played a critical role in early communities. Learn the fascinating history of this noble beverage, from the Ancient world to modern day with Elmhurst History Museum Executive Director Dave Oberg. Our journey starts with early Egyptian and Mesopotamian brews and follows the spread of this refreshing beverage worldwide to the dawn of the craft beer movement in modern times. You'll find beer proved crucial to the growth of culture, the spread of commerce and the health of humankind.

WHAT IS LUDOPHILIA?
For any of you who have missed it until now, Ludophilia is the name we've given to our annual 4-day boardgaming (and craft beer sharing) extravaganza in the far northwest suburbs of Chicago!   It's much too friendly and informal to be called a "convention".  It's just an excuse for friends and friends-of-friends to get together in a large-ish hotel conference room with a few hundred board games and have the chance to strategize, socialize, and relax uninterrupted.  Everyone brings favorite games (and beverages) to share, and then it's open house at the hotel Thursday morning through Sunday morning!  Set up your own lodging plans if you want to stay overnight, and everyone is mostly responsible for their own food and drink.
